Eliashib the priest; the high priest, Neh_3:1, or some other priest so called, there being divers Eliashibs in or about this time, Ezr_10:6,24,27,36, though the first seems most probable, by comparing this verse with Neh_13:28, and with Neh_12:10,11.



The oversight of the chamber, i.e. of the chambers, as appears from the following verse, and from Neh_13:9, where it is called chambers, and from the nature of the thing, the high priest having the chief power over the house of God, and all the chambers belonging to it. The singular number for the plural.



Allied unto Tobiah, the Ammonite, and a violent enemy to God’s people. So this is noted as a great blemish to Eliashib, and as the cause of his other miscarriage, noted Neh_13:5.
